MediaCo Holding Inc. (MDIA) — AI Stock Analysis
MediaCo Holding Inc. operates radio stations and outdoor advertising displays in the United States. The company focuses on radio broadcasting in New York City and outdoor advertising across several states.

What They Do
- Owns and operates WQHT-FM and WBLS-FM radio stations in New York City.
- Provides music and talk show programming to the New York City metropolitan area.
- Operates outdoor advertising displays, including bulletins, posters, and digital billboards.
- Offers advertising space on its outdoor displays in Georgia, Alabama, South Carolina, Florida, Kentucky, West Virginia, and Ohio.
- Provides digital advertising services to businesses.
- Offers event sponsorship opportunities to promote brands and engage with target audiences.
- Connects advertisers with diverse urban audiences through its radio and outdoor advertising platforms.

What does MediaCo Holding Inc. do?
MediaCo Holding Inc. operates in the communication services sector, focusing on radio broadcasting and outdoor advertising. The company owns and operates WQHT-FM and WBLS-FM radio stations in New York City, providing music, talk shows, and advertising opportunities. Additionally, MediaCo manages approximately 3,500 outdoor advertising displays across several states, offering businesses a platform for traditional and digital out-of-home advertising. The company also provides digital advertising solutions and event sponsorship opportunities, creating integrated marketing solutions for its clients. MediaCo aims to connect advertisers with diverse urban audiences through its various platforms.

What are the main risks for MDIA?
MediaCo Holding Inc. faces several key risks that investors may want to research. The company's high debt levels could limit its financial flexibility and ability to invest in growth opportunities. The negative profit margin and gross margin indicate significant operational inefficiencies or high costs relative to revenue. Increased competition from streaming services and digital audio platforms could erode its radio advertising revenue. Economic downturns could reduce advertising spending, impacting both its radio and outdoor advertising segments. Regulatory changes affecting the broadcasting and advertising industries could also pose a risk to its operations.
